My dad just got a 2001 Benz CLK320 with no owners manual! I found a sticker under the hood saying Mobil1 is recommended. But no weight was spec. Anyone have this car living in 20-90 degree temp area?

FWIW Mobil Oz web site says M1 5W50 or Super XHP which covers 10W40, 15W40, 15W50, 20W50 dino oils for CLK320.

That car should take about 9.5 liters of Mobil-1 0W-40. However, the engine is also spec'd for 0W-30, 5W-40, 10W-40, etc. It's a beast so it isn't very picky about what it eats. [ March 09, 2004, 06:21 AM: Message edited by: FowVay ]
